Concurrent Enrollment Information

May 15, 2025

Launch the media gallery 1 player

Oklahoma Union High School

Concurrent Enrollment

Coffeyville Community College

Tuition: $50 per credit hour
$150 per 3-hour class

Fees: 
In-person class: $60 per credit hour
$180 per 3-hour class
Online class: $107 per credit hour
$321 per 3-hour class

 

Total:
In-person class: $330 per 3-hour class
Online class: $471 per 3-hour class

Comp I and Comp II at OKU:
$150 each semester

1. Apply to CCC at 

https://www.coffeyville.edu/student-services/admissions

2.Get Permission to Enroll Paper outside of counselor’s office, complete form and bring to counselor to submit

3.Complete the Required Pre-enrollment Steps listed 

Here: https://docs.google.com/document/d/1v5k2Dad3ljO1VcA0fohHzbF6OjHAnMRI2xa_S1MpNQs/edit

4. Register online for classes through Red Connect account

Rogers State University








 

 

High school senior and junior concurrent college enrollment students are eligible for up to 18 hours of tuition waiver during the fall, spring and summer terms. Students are required to pay all other expenses including fees, books and tuition above 18 hours per year.

 

Fees: $97 per credit hour

 

$291 per 3-hour class

Step 1: The student is required to have a 3.0 GPA (unweighted) OR a 19 on the ACT/PreACT Composite.
If you do not clear each ACT subject with a 19+ score or have not taken the ACT, you are required to take placement testing.
If you don’t know if you need placement testing, contact admissions at 918-343-7546 or admissions@rsu.edu.

 

Step 2: Submit your Application for Admission to RSU at https://www.rsu.edu/admissions/apply-now/

Step 3: Send us your high school transcript through Parchment:

https://www.parchment.com/u/registration/19901/account

 

Step 4: Permission from parent/guardian and principal/high school counselor is required.
The RSU admission application requires the student to provide those email addresses.
An email will then be automatically sent to those email addresses for them to grant the student permission.

NEO-Miami

The High School Tuition Waiver provides for up to 18 eligible credit hours for all Oklahoma seniors, and up to 12 eligible credit hours for all Oklahoma juniors. It is the responsibility of the student to pay for any course fees and materials.

 

Fees: $64.75 per credit hour

 

$194.25 per 3-hour class

1.Submit an application for admission at https://neo.edu/become-a-student/

2.Complete National ACT / Pre-ACT test

3.Submit an official high school transcript through Parchment:

https://www.parchment.com/u/registration/19901/account

 

Seniors and Juniors must achieve a minimum composite score of 19 on the National ACT/ Pre-ACT or 3.0 high school GPA.

If the student does not have a National ACT/ Pre-ACT score of 19 in the subject area they wish to enroll in,
they will be allowed to take one placement test per subject per semester.
If they receive a qualifying score on the placement test, they will be allowed to enroll in the subject area tested.
Call the NEO Success Center to schedule a placement test.

NEO Success Center: - 918-540-6208

Oklahoma State University

















































 

Seniors
Oklahoma resident seniors eligible for concurrent enrollment will not incur out-of-pocket costs for dual credit course tuition and fees. Eligible seniors receive a tuition waiver from the state (up to 18 hours total) and a scholarship from the OSU Foundation to cover fees for online dual enrollment. There is a one-time application fee required for admission to OSU.

 

Juniors
Oklahoma juniors receive a reduced rate of $775 per course for the online concurrent program. Oklahoma resident high school juniors can receive a tuition waiver for up to nine credit hours for the 2024-2025 academic year. This offer is available to the first 100 students who enroll for each eligible semester (summer 2024, fall 2024 and spring 2025). Students are still responsible for paying course fees.

1. Apply

Pay application fee ($40)  or submit fee waiver

Oklahoma State University accepts application fee waivers from ACT, SAT and NACAC.
You can have your high school guidance counselor forward your application fee waiver
through email at admissions@okstate.edu, by fax at (405) 744-7092, or through the mail to the address listed above.
Oklahoma State University also accepts application fee waivers from students based on demonstrated need
(for example: a student on free or reduced lunch programs). Your high school guidance counselor should send a letter that explains the demonstrated need through email at admissions@okstate.edu, or by fax (405) 744-7092. 

 

 2.Submit official transcripts & test scores

Have your high school send Oklahoma State University your official transcript through Parchment:

https://www.parchment.com/u/registration/19901/account

We accept test scores reported on your official high school transcript. 

 3. Beginning in summer 2022, students have the option to apply to OSU without consideration of a test score. Students who select this option on the application will be considered for admission based on a full review of their high school transcript. Class rank is not required for test optional admission.  

 

4. Submit a signed concurrent approval form

Once you've completed your online application for concurrent enrollment, you will need to get approval from a parent or guardian, as well as a high school official to approve your participation. You can submit an electronic approval request form available upon completion of the online application.

Tulsa Community College





















 

Seniors: TCC will waive tuition via Oklahoma’s senior tuition waiver program. By Oklahoma statute, each Oklahoma high school senior who meets the eligibility requirements for concurrent enrollment shall be entitled to receive a tuition waiver equivalent to the amount of resident tuition for a maximum of 18 eligible credit hours in their senior year beginning June 1 following the eleventh grade. The tuition waiver may be used in the summer, fall, or spring. 

 

Juniors: In addition to the state of Oklahoma’s senior tuition waiver, TCC provides a tuition waiver to each Oklahoma high school junior who meets the admission and enrollment eligibility requirements for high school students. Juniors will be awarded a tuition waiver equivalent to the amount of resident tuition for a maximum of 12 eligible credit hours in their junior year. 

 

Fees:

$29.45 per credit hour

$88.35 per 3-hour class

Oklahoma Wesleyan University

ON-CAMPUS COURSES

$285 per 3-hour class. ($95 per credit hour.) plus book fees. No administrative fees.

 

ONLINE COURSES

$285 per 3-hour class. No book fees. No additional fees.
